As jobs vanish at home, Nepalis line up for overseas opportunities
Nepal, July 31 -- The dream of finding better opportunities abroad is drawing an increasing number of Nepalis out of the country, with long queues of people seeking foreign employment continuing to grow.
Despite repeated government promises to create jobs at home, thousands of young people are lining up daily at government offices responsible for foreign employment, passports and overseas work procedures. The Department of Foreign Employment (DoFE), the Korea Employment Permit System (EPS) Branch and the Department of Passports (DoP) have witnessed a sharp rise in the number of service seekers compared to previous years.
